Selecting the right carpenter for your project is crucial to achieving the desired outcome. Here are some tips to help you make an informed decision:
Start by researching local carpenters online and reading reviews from previous clients. Ask friends, family, or neighbours for recommendations based on their experiences. Word-of-mouth referrals are often a reliable source of information.
Ensure the carpenter you choose has the necessary qualifications, certifications, and experience relevant to your project. Experienced carpenters are more likely to deliver high-quality work and handle unexpected challenges effectively.
Obtain quotes from multiple carpenters to compare pricing and services offered. Be wary of unusually low quotes, as they may indicate subpar materials or workmanship. A detailed quote should outline the scope of work, materials, timeline, and costs involved.
Carpenters in Southend-on-Sea are involved in a variety of projects that enhance the functionality and aesthetics of homes and businesses. Some common projects include:
Many homeowners in Southend-on-Sea hire carpenters for renovation projects, such as updating kitchens, bathrooms, and living spaces. Carpenters can create custom cabinetry, install new flooring, and build feature walls to transform the look and feel of a home.
With the town's beautiful coastal setting, outdoor structures like decks, pergolas, and garden sheds are popular projects. Carpenters design and build these structures to withstand the local climate while providing functional and attractive outdoor spaces.
Businesses in Southend-on-Sea often require carpenters for commercial fit-outs, which involve designing and constructing interiors for offices, shops, and restaurants. Carpenters work closely with business owners to create spaces that reflect their brand and meet operational needs.
The carpentry industry is continually evolving, with new techniques and technologies enhancing the quality and efficiency of work. Carpenters in Southend-on-Sea are embracing these innovations to deliver superior results.
Many carpenters are adopting sustainable practices, such as using eco-friendly materials and implementing waste reduction strategies. This not only benefits the environment but also appeals to clients who prioritise sustainability in their projects.
Modern carpenters utilise advanced tools and equipment, such as laser levels, CNC machines, and cordless power tools, to improve precision and efficiency. These tools enable carpenters to complete projects faster and with greater accuracy.
